Was Amy infected in The Ruins?

It acts as an epilogue and informs viewers that Amy does indeed suffer death – probably due to the vines inside her body – and suggests that the caretaker will become infected by the flowers and most likely go on to spread the infection.

Where was Ruins filmed?

Queensland, Australia
The shooting of this film took place in Queensland, Australia. According to The Miami Herald, “Smith was two-thirds done with the book when Ben Stiller’s production company, Red Hour Films, bought the screen rights based on an outline.

What was the plant in The Ruins?

The Predatory Vines are the main antagonists in 2008 movie “The Ruins,” based on the book of the same name. The Predatory Vines are a mysterious species of creeping vine originating from Mexico, growing on an isolated temple (but potentially spread further as a result of the depicted events).

What is The Ruins based on?

The story of the film is based on Scott Smith’s novel of the same name. Scott Smith was also the one who wrote the screenplay. The story is based around the discovery of an ancient Mayan Temple. The ruins are covered by an unknown plant that isn’t as innocent as they appear to be.
